Introduction
If you are in a relationship and you are both overweight, ask yourself if it’s something you discuss as a couple. You can help support each other to lose weight, particularly if either or both of you think it’s affecting your sexuality. If you don’t talk about this, it’s now time you did. You need to be completely open and honest with each other, but very gentle and understanding and tell each other what you would like the others ideal weight to be. What weight would you want your partner to be, for you to find them their most sexually attractive? Ask what it is about this ideal weight body that your partner finds the biggest turn on. Did one or the other of you have this ideal, or near to, body weight when you met? We do need to be realistic and most people put on a little weight in their 40’s and 50’s which is natural, but one stone of extra weight is quite enough for anyone! It’s also important to realise that one stone can creep up to one and a half very easily, so if you are a little cuddly, you need to make sure you maintain your weight, rather than gain anymore. If you and your partner are being honest with each other, most people will say they found their partner more attractive when they were thinner.
Sex in longer term relationships can be dull – it depends entirely on both people involved, but when dullness is also shrouded with obesity, there’s often not much chance of sex at all, let alone great sex. Work, children, life in general, always pushing sex out of the queue, but when you’re overweight, sex is often not even in the queue! It’s no wonder really. If you ask most people their ideal sexual fantasy perfect person, most will choose someone fit and healthy and gorgeous. It’s in our DNA to be that way. Thankfully, it’s also in our DNA to love the person on the inside, because we don’t all look like George Clooney or Julia Roberts, but when you fall in love with the fitter, slimmer healthier person and they change, it can cause resentment and a lack of attraction.

The benefits of being slim
Have you ever noticed when perhaps you're in love, or feeling great about yourself, happy, positive and on top of the world, how other people look at you? Have you felt like that recently? Not easy when you are disgusted with your size and ashamed of your body. You are the only one who can change this. Losing weight will mean your health will improve, but most of all it means you will improve because you will gain back your sense of self worth as an individual. It will be a huge sense of accomplishment-something you have done for yourself, by yourself. It will also be something you will want to hang onto forever. Whether you're single or married, you are going to be more attractive and sexier to others when you're not overweight. Your general health will improve and you will not be so susceptible to the diseases associated with obesity, so you may well prolong your life. We all know that we require exercise, but this is not easy when you're carrying around a few extra kilos of weight, so when that goes, exercise will be easier for you. No matter how overweight you are, we all have to start from somewhere and that somewhere is you making the decision to change your body.
You were not born overweight and the reason you are now is that you have been using the wrong fuel in the body that's your machine. Not only have you been using the wrong fuel, but you have been overdosing on the amount your machine needs to use. This is what has caused the problem. You have got to get off the dieter's hamster wheel and stop obsessing about food. When you learn to understand the relationship your body has with food, you will realise that eating, first and foremost is about being healthy and secondly for pleasure.
